Hydraulic systems can store potential energy in a device known as an accumulator, which functions much like a rechargeable battery in an electrical circuit. An accumulator is a pressure vessel that stores this fluid under pressure to supplement pump flow, absorb shocks, and provide. . Hydraulic systems use a nearly incompressible fluid, often oil, to convert mechanical energy into hydraulic power. This process allows for the generation, control, and transmission of powerful, precise force for a wide range of mechanical operations.

Flywheel Energy Storage Systems (FESS) rely on a mechanical working principle: An electric motor is used to spin a rotor of high inertia up to 20,000-50,000 rpm. Electrical energy is thus converted to kinetic energy for storage. For discharging, the motor acts as a generator, braking the rotor to. .
